About Axiom

At Axiom, our vision is to unlock insights from event data at any scale. We believe that unified access to all event data, all the time, makes organizations far more effective. That’s why we built Axiom: the first cloud-native data store designed specifically for timestamped events, providing live-streaming, search, reporting, and monitoring capabilities. Built from the ground up, Axiom delivers performance and scalability at a lower cost. Today, thousands of companies — from ambitious startups to the world’s largest enterprises — trust Axiom to make sense of event data for engineering, security, and operational use cases.

Our work so far is just the first step towards our vision. We’ve raised funds from top-tier investors including Crane Venture Partners, LocalGlobe, Fly VC, Mango Capital, as well as leading angels like former GitHub CEO Nat Friedman, former Heroku co-founder Adam Wiggins, and Vercel CEO Guillermo Rauch. About the Role

The Lead Sales Engineer role at Axiom plays a crucial role in connecting our technical capabilities with our sales efforts. They are responsible for explaining the technical aspects of our products to potential clients, ensuring that our solutions perfectly match their needs and challenges.

As a Sales Engineer, you will:

  • Lead technical presentations and product demonstrations tailored to prospective clients' needs.
  • Formulate solution proposals by closely engaging with prospects to comprehend their technical landscape and challenges.
  • Construct and refine foundational pre-sales processes, protocols, templates, and documentation to streamline sales engineering functions.
  • Collaborate intimately with sales, product, and engineering teams to ensure our product offerings are congruent with market demands and customer requirements.
  • Establish the framework and groundwork for the subsequent expansion of the sales engineering team, contributing to Axiom’s scalability and long-term growth.
  • Take ownership of the technical relationship of deals through the sales cycle.
  • Maintain relationships with customers through their lifecycle with Axiom, help expand their use, and provide feedback to the Product Management team.
  • Play an integral part in defining and executing our go-to-market strategy - exploring new use cases, integrations, partnerships, etc.

You might be a good fit if:

  • A deep understanding of observability tools, system architectures, and software development, with knowledge of cloud-native technologies is required.
  • Experience with modern observability and log management platforms is required. This includes everything from data ingest, to parsing, to manipulation and visualization of the data.
  • Exceptional communication skills to effectively convey complex technical concepts to a diverse audience, from engineers to executives.
  • Additional experience needed includes distributed data stores, data shipping services, cloud providers, SSO concepts, and cloud orchestration.
  • Experience with sales processes such as MEDDPICC in a presales or architect role.
  • Demonstrated leadership potential and strategic thinking, with experience in leading initiatives and developing effective strategies in a sales engineering environment.
  • Adaptable and collaborative mindset, able to seamlessly collaborate with different teams to align product capabilities with customer needs.
